All that's bright must fade, The brightest still the fleetest; All that's sweet was made But to be lost when sweetest. - Thomas Moore

Thomas Moore quotes

Author's Biography:
Name: Thomas Moore
Born: 28 May 1779. Died: 25 February 1852
Profession: Poet | Musician |
